Solar batteries store the energy that is collected from your solar panels. The higher your battery''s capacity, the more solar energy it can store. In order to use batteries as part of your solar installation, you need solar panels, a charge controller, and an inverter.

Battery capacity refers to the total amount of energy your solar panel battery can store, and usable capacity means the amount one can use, which is usually calculated by the depth of discharge. The amount of storage and usable capacity, measured in kilowatt-hours (kWh), directly influences your solar battery storage system''s cost.

Solar panel system size. The amount of power your solar panels produce determines how much they can charge your battery system during the day. It''s important to size both your solar panel and battery storage systems to work together; there''s no use in installing a huge battery if you''re never going to use its full capacity.

The biggest factor that impacts the price of a solar battery is its capacity – the total amount of energy that it can store. For instance, there are 5 kWh batteries used mostly for improving the economics of solar, and there are 40 kWh battery systems that can back up your entire home during a power outage.
